According to inkorr.com: U.S. President Donald Trump has begun constructing a new luxurious ballroom on the grounds of the White House, which will be separate from the main building. As part of this project, the East Wing of the residence is undergoing a complete renovation, which, according to Trump, will be the largest upgrade in the history of the White House.

"For over 150 years, every president has dreamed of a ballroom for holding important events, parties, and state visits," Trump said. He added that it is a great honor for him to be the first to realize this long-awaited project.

The president noted that the funding for the construction is provided by private sources, including donations from American companies and patriots, without the use of government funds. Trump believes that the new ballroom will remain an important venue for business events for many generations to come.

Renovation of the East Wing of the White House

The cost of this project is about $250 million. It includes the replacement of the East Wing, which was built in 1902 and has been renovated several times. The new ballroom, designed for 650 people, will allow for large ceremonial events that were impossible to organize in the old facilities.
